Linux下轻松搭建拨号VPN,无需复杂配置,小白也能快速上手!
在当今数字化时代,网络安全和隐私保护越来越受到重视,无论是远程办公、访问境外资源,还是防止公共Wi-Fi被窃听,使用虚拟私人网络(VPN)已成为每个Linux用户必备的技能,很多人误以为配置VPN必须依赖图形界面或专业工具,在Linux命令行中,通过简单的拨号(PPP)方式建立VPN连接,不仅高效稳定,还能让你真正掌握底层原理,我就带你一步步用Linux原生工具,轻松实现拨号式VPN连接——无需安装第三方软件,纯命令操作,小白也能看懂!
你需要一个支持PPTP或L2TP/IPsec协议的VPN服务提供商,常见如ExpressVPN、NordVPN等都提供Linux客户端,但如果你想自己动手,可以用开源项目如pptpclient或strongswan来搭建,这里以PPTP为例,因为它配置简单、兼容性好。
第一步:安装必要的软件包
在Ubuntu/Debian系统中,运行以下命令:
sudo apt update sudo apt install pptp-linux ppp
如果是CentOS/RHEL系统,则使用:
sudo yum install pptp-linux ppp
第二步:创建配置文件
编辑/etc/ppp/peers/vpn文件,写入你的服务器地址、用户名和密码:
sudo nano /etc/ppp/peers/vpn ```如下(请替换为你自己的信息):
pty "pptp your.vpn.server.com --nolaunchpppd" name your_username password your_password require-mppe-128 noauth persist debug
第三步:启动拨号连接
执行命令:
```bash
sudo pon vpn
如果一切顺利,你会看到日志输出显示连接成功,IP地址分配完成,此时可以测试连通性:
ping 8.8.8.8
第四步:断开连接
使用以下命令终止会话:
sudo poff vpn
整个过程不到五分钟,而且你可以在脚本中自动化这个流程,比如设置定时任务自动连接或加入开机自启,更重要的是,这种方式完全基于Linux原生模块,不依赖GUI,非常适合服务器环境、树莓派、NAS设备等无桌面场景。
如果你追求更高的安全性,可以尝试使用OpenConnect(用于Cisco AnyConnect)或StrongSwan(支持IPsec),它们虽然配置略复杂,但提供了更强的数据加密和身份验证机制。
Linux下的拨号VPN不是“老古董”,而是现代数字生活的利器,它不仅能帮你绕过地域限制,更能提升上网安全,掌握这些命令,你就不再是被动的用户,而是一个主动掌控网络的高手!别再犹豫了,动手试试吧,你会发现——原来技术也可以如此优雅而强大!

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速














